ABSTRACT (Summary of the invention) The present invention relates to a three position table for the purpose of holding three separate and individual working tools. These tools, for example, could be; a combination belt and disk sander, a bench grinder, and a scroll saw. The table can be adapted to hold different types of machines similar to the above eg: drill press, lathe, router, edger, planer etc. Tools such as a table saw or a radial arm saw would not mormally be adapted, however, custom designing could be made. The purpose of the table is to enable the Home Hobbyist (do it yourselfer) or Light Industrial User the opportunity to reduce the space necessary to accomodate various machine/tools while maintaining the ability to bring them into use, one at a time, speedily when required. This three position revolving worktable provides each position as a sturdy shelf to which the tool is securely fashioned. As each shelf is brought up to the top position it is locked in place. This allows the machine to be used without hinderence from the other two machines. When one of the other machines is required the shelf is unlocked, the table is rotated to bring the the desired machine to the top position, locked in place, and that machine is ready for use.
